FSH
Follicle-Stimulating Hormone, a gonadotropin involved in the regulation of reproductive processes such as gamete production and menstrual cycle.
Estrogen
A group of steroid hormones that play an essential role in the development and maintenance of female characteristics and reproductive processes.
Corpus Luteum
A temporary endocrine structure in female ovaries that produces hormones, primarily progesterone, following ovulation.
Zona Pellucida
The thick, transparent covering that surrounds the plasma membrane of a mammalian ovum.
